What does a network firewall security analyst do?

A Network Firewall Security Analyst is responsible for designing, implementing, and managing firewall systems to protect an organization’s network from unauthorized access and cyber threats. They monitor network traffic, analyze security incidents, update firewall rules, and ensure compliance with security policies. Their work is crucial in maintaining the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of an organization’s data and IT infrastructure.

What are some common challenges faced by network firewall security analysts, and how can they be addressed?

Network Firewall Security Analysts often encounter challenges such as managing complex firewall rule sets, ensuring minimal downtime during updates, and keeping up with evolving cyber threats. A proactive approach involves regularly reviewing and optimizing firewall configurations, collaborating closely with IT and security teams, and staying current through ongoing training and threat intelligence feeds. Adopting automation tools for monitoring and reporting can also help streamline processes and reduce human error.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a network firewall security anal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Network Firewall Security Analyst, you need strong knowledge of network protocols, firewall management, threat analysis, and typically a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with firewall platforms (such as Cisco ASA, Palo Alto, or Fortinet), intrusion detection/prevention systems, and certifications like CISSP or CISM are highly valued.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are essential soft skills for assessing risks and collaborating with IT teams. These skills are crucial to protect organizational networks from cyber threats and ensure continuous, secure business operations.
